Table of calculations for the ampere turns necessary to produce the required magnetic flux.

Identifier  ExFiles\Box 35\4\  scan 147
Date  30th April 1923 guessed
  
AMPERE TURNS NECESSARY TO PRODUCE FLUX REQUIRED

Part. | Matl. | Length ("). | Virtual section (sq.ins). | Total Flux. | Flux density Inch units. | Cg. units. | H.{Arthur M. Hanbury - Head Complaints} | AT. per inch. | A.T.
---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| ---
Armature teeth. | Lamin. Iron. | .30 | 5.7 x .130 x 2.75 = 2.04 | 167000 | 82000 | 12700 | 15 | 30 | 9
Armature core. | " | .90 | 2 x .70 x 2.75 = 3.85 | 167000 | 43400 | 6730 | 5 | 10 | 9
Air gap. | Air. | .015 | 1.80 x 2.75 = 4.95 | 167000 | 33800 | 5230 | 5230 | 10500 | 158
Pole core. | M.S | .675 | .95 x 2.75 = 2.61 | 200000 | 76700 | 11900 | 15 | 30 | 20
Yoke. | M.S. | 1.96 | 2 x .275 x 4.0 = 2.2 | 200000 | 91000 | 14100 | 26 | 52 | 102

Total 298
Say 300
